Great Horned Owl crafts an impactful sound, spanning from riveting rock to introspective folk, on the new album Longyear. The Portland, Oregon-based project of multi-instrumentalist and singer-songwriter Vanderson Langjahr caught our ears with a couple tracks last month, including “Annie, I’m Leaving,” featuring Marissa Nadler. Those tracks are amongst the many highlights on Longyear, an album with consistently compelling songwriting.
Standout track “It Wasn’t Anything” casts a reflective spell, with Langjahr’s affecting voice complemented by a solemnly beautiful acoustic guitar backing. “Standing with you by the lake that night, beneath the trees, the insects buzzing,” he sings, showing a poetic grasp of vivid imagery as soul-searching, heart-aching sentiments pair gorgeously with the late-night tonal allure.
The album’s title track is another gem, closing out Longyear with a dynamic production that swells from quaint guitar trickling into anthemic rock vigor. Also complemented by a visually striking music video, “Longyear” enamors in its bursts of warming guitars past the one-minute turn, while references to sunlight glimmer into tender guitar twangs. The album is abundant with quality productions, melodic with heartfelt appeal.
